Why This Training is Essential

Undetected gas leaks or hazardous atmospheres can lead to fires, explosions, toxic exposure, or asphyxiation. A reliable gas detection system, combined with trained personnel, helps organizations:

  • Prevent accidents through early detection of hazardous gases
  • Protect workers from toxic exposure and oxygen deficiency
  • Ensure compliance with safety regulations and standards
  • Improve emergency response and evacuation readiness
  • Maintain operational safety and reliability
